About the book

J. A. Friis's «The Monastery of Petschenga» delves deeply into the historical and cultural significance of the Petschenga Monastery, situated on the remote borders of Northwestern Russia. This meticulously researched work combines rich narrative prose with detailed historic analysis, employing a scholarly yet accessible tone that invites both academics and general readers. Through intricate descriptions and engaging storytelling, Friis illustrates the monastery's architectural marvels and its extraordinary resilience amidst cultural and political upheaval, all while situating it within the broader context of Eastern Orthodox Christianity and its evolution over centuries.
